Title
Femtosecond surface plasmon interferometry with gold nanostructures

Abstract
We measure the ultrafast electron dynamics in gold via ultrafast surface plasmon interferometry. A new plasmonic microinterferometer with tilted slit-groove pair is used to unambiguously determine changes of real and imaginary parts of the dielectric function.
